Abstract
An optical switch based on the multimode interference (MMI) coupler is demonstrated in this letter. The device is designed and fabricated in polymeric materials and the thermooptic (TO) effect of polymers, which has a negative TO coefficient, is employed to change the self-imaging effect of a side-heated MMI coupler and realize optical switching. The switching power is only 22 mW. The experimental results show that the crosstalk of the switch is about -20 dB at both the cross and bar states.
